Priebus: CNBC Won't Moderate Another Debate,We're "Re-Evaluating" All The Others (Shortened)
Breitbart.com ^ | October 30, 2015 | Ian Hanchett

Posted on 10/30/2015 2:53:14 AM PDT by Biggirl

RNC Chairman Reince Priebus stated that CNBC won’t moderate another Republican debate after its “crap sandwich,” and that all future debates will be “re-evaluated” on Thursday’s “Hannity” on the Fox News Channel.
